Output 019d5cba5436670237580603bfbc181feffbe9a7c290e269348eea9d564e57bd:2

value
314680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3c0afa15481382622a68aa91b030d0ae3eedf8c OP_EQUAL
address
3J5ThwfK9CTUFizSxi4MccBfUYfYyB8uRy
transaction
019d5cba5436670237580603bfbc181feffbe9a7c290e269348eea9d564e57bd
confirmations
510846
spent
true